About the Library
Our college library building was opened on 29.09.1980 by His Excellency Sri. Prabhudas Patwari, the then Governor of Tamil Nadu, under the presidentship of late Sri. A.G. Subburaman M.P. The library functions on a computerized basis and serves the needs of students across various disciplines. All students and staff of Sourashtra College are members of the library.
A total of 61,500 books and 9 newspapers across various disciplines are available. Open access system is followed, and a Barcoding System handles book issue, return, and renewal for research scholars, postgraduate and undergraduate students, and staff.

Library Holdings
- The college General Library was established in 1971 with 500 volumes of books
- The collection has now risen to over 61,500
- The entire library was computerised in 2009
- Bar Code Technology was introduced in 2017โ18
- Library automation was introduced in 2010

Library User Rules
- All enrolled students are members of the Central Library; teaching and non-teaching staff also use library facilities
- Open Access System โ users can enter the stack room and choose books freely
- Books borrowed through ROVAN LMS (Library Management Software)
- UG students: 3 books; PG students: 4 books at a time, for 15 days
- Late fine: โน1/day for the belated period
- Lost book/journal: 3ร actual cost + fine, or replace with latest edition
- Staff can borrow 10 books per semester, plus non-current journals/magazines
- Books can be retained and extended during examinations
